Output 7af668170e38e848314b715f8ffa34b9b135b320ee60d138f4fafcd8a4f9f326:1

value
67600
script pubkey
OP_0 OP_PUSHBYTES_20 cebfc8d735debad1e53aeafa1bf5f1c749863451
address
bc1qe6lu34e4m6adref6atapha03caycvdz3ahxycp
transaction
7af668170e38e848314b715f8ffa34b9b135b320ee60d138f4fafcd8a4f9f326
confirmations
127960
spent
true